Same as in the first session in the last day of the camp Carl had the lecture about FIBA guidelines to mechanics. Therefore we talked almost an hour about the proper way to toss. So by solid movement, when you start to toss what is the level of the ball, and how to escort the ball with your hands 🙂

And if there is a mistake during jump ball, who is responsible for it. You are not there alone. All the ref team is responsible. Still before the games Steve had an hour on pick and roll, how to evaluate it, we were breaking down the clips. This was a great lecture, super useful. Steve taught us how to have an active mindset for the screen. How to catch an isolated play and always to look for competitive match in your area of responsibility.
